It’s no surprise VetPride promoted Brenton Hill to be the new manager of valet for the VA Medical Center in Hampton, Va. Brenton’s exemplary performance as a valet attendant represents the core values at VetPride Services. Professionally motivated, caring, and respectful, Brenton’s commitment to serving people put his name at the top of the list.
“I just really enjoy helping people,” he says. “I hear a lot of stories from the veterans we help, and I definitely have a lot to be thankful for.”
Brenton has worked for VetPride for about three years. He was originally part of the previous company that ran valet. When VetPride took over, he was one of the employees who stayed.
“I really enjoy working for VetPride now,” he says, “they really care about their employees. They’re a family business, and they treat all of us like family.”
Brenton is always looking to improve, to take the next step. He looks up to people who are business minded, and who have done great things for people. His role models range from Bill Gates to Tyler Perry. An entrepreneur himself, Brenton runs his own entertainment business on the side, managing local DJ’s, and doing sound for live bands.
When he isn’t working, Brenton enjoys traveling, being outdoors, go-carting, skating, and bowling. For him, success means reaching a level of comfort and contentment in life, in whatever he does.
